What is Personality?
00:18
The inner psychological characteristics that both determine and reflect how a person acts and think
00:22
The emphasis in this definition is on inner characteristics
00:24
Specific qualities
00:25
Attributes
00:26
Traits
00:26
Factors
00:27
Mannerisms
00:28
- that distinguish one individual from other individuals.

Freudian Theory and “Product Personality”
01:08
Human drives are largely unconscious and that consumers are primarily unaware of their true reasons for buying what they buy.
01:09
Consumer researchers using Freud’s personality theory see consumer purchases and /or consumption situations as a reflection and extension of the consumer’s own personality.
01:09
Example consumer’s appearance and possessions: Grooming, clothing, and jewellery
